The Office of Enterprise Technology Services (ETS) is established within the Department of Accounting and General Services (DAGS) to integrate all of the State’s Executive Branch Information Technology (IT) administration, services, and operations into a single, cohesive strategy to reduce costs, deliver effective government services, increase project process efficiencies, improve the overall cyber security posture, and provide accountability and transparency to all constituents the State of Hawaii serves.
The function of the Technology Support Services Branch (TSSB) is to provide planning, development, design, consulting, management, and other technical support services to State agencies for the utilization of public and government access systems using web technologies to facilitate information gathering and information sharing among agencies and the public.
The position is a fully independent journey worker, accountable for the end-to-end delivery of IT services from the State of Hawaii Services Oriented Infrastructure (SOI) to ensure that all IT services are delivered to customer satisfaction. This includes processes for ETS and overall vendor performance of the specified services and ensuring that the cost/benefit impacts are carefully evaluated, and customer satisfaction is not compromised. The incumbent has responsibility for overseeing the day-to-day operations of the managed service/vendor, working in conjunction with the Chief Information Officer (CIO), project management office and contracts management office.
